Output 076f81d709dc4ce296df176cc3a1a5f8cd042be5bec4b5c596ade327ab37cb65:1

value
564263
script pubkey
OP_0 OP_PUSHBYTES_20 a9b3c2053571a14480891e81faa088b8e37e78a7
address
bc1q4xeuypf4wxs5fqyfr6ql4gyghr3hu798mzjqwu
transaction
076f81d709dc4ce296df176cc3a1a5f8cd042be5bec4b5c596ade327ab37cb65
confirmations
172367
spent
true